My bags are packed and I'm ready to go...

M. stayed late at work today, so when I called, there were several of the guys from his unit (including his commander, first sergeant and his roommate, Chief) listening as he inadvertently said, "Hey honey!" when he answered the phone. And it turns out that that one greeting was ALL the encouragement his office-mates needed to really turn up the charm! I could hear all of them in the background, yelling (mostly for my benefit, I'm guessing!) "Hey honey!" and "I loooove you!" And you know, the harder M. tried to get off the phone, the more obnoxious his coworkers got....I was laughing too hard to be much help in actually getting him off the phone! Anyway, it's nice that they've been consistent in giving him a hard time...right up until he goes on leave. I guess that's the price we pay for having known all of them before we were married, through the engagement up until now...the seemingly endless teasing! So, the reason he was still in the office tonight with everyone else? They were making sure he had all of the information he needs before embarking on his travels. So, even though I don't know exactly when (or where) M.'s travels will take him first, it looks like the time to leave is getting close and I'm looking forward to being here to meet him as he arrives in Germany, whenever that is. So, godspeed, M.! And I will see you soon...
